Optimize Your Business Profile for Maximum Impact
Start by claiming and verifying your Google Business Profile if you haven’t already. Ensure all information is accurate, complete, and up-to-date. Add relevant categories, a detailed description, and current business hours to make your profile as informative as possible. Think of this as setting the foundation—without a solid base, nothing else sticks. I once neglected to update my business hours during a holiday season, which confused customers and hurt my ranking. Correcting this immediately improved related visibility.

Gather and Respond to Customer Reviews Regularly
Encourage satisfied customers to leave authentic reviews. Respond to each review professionally, addressing concerns and thanking reviewers to boost engagement. Reviews are social signals that influence your local pack ranking—think of them as word-of-mouth on steroids. I once prompted a few loyal clients for reviews afterward, leading to a noticeable jump in my profile’s visibility within weeks. Consistency in review management is key to maintaining a lively, trustworthy profile.

Optimize Your Map Marker and Location Signals
Ensure your storefront’s physical location is accurately marked on Google Maps. Use consistent NAP (Name, Address, Phone number) information across all directories. Control proximity signals by ensuring your business’s geo-coordinates are precise, and consider using internal links from your website to your Google Business Profile. I corrected a misplaced map pin, which immediately improved my local pack visibility, especially in mobile searches.

I personally rely on tools like BrightLocal for tracking keyword rankings and review management, as it provides real-time updates and comprehensive insights into your local SEO performance. For citation consistency, Moz Local helps ensure your NAP information stays uniform across directories, preventing Google algorithm confusion. Regularly updating and monitoring your Google Business Profile using these platforms keeps your listing fresh and competitive. Additionally, scheduling monthly audits using Google’s Looker Studio dashboard allows me to visualize rankings and identify dips before they impact visibility.
